Transaction 595c62e274c719b33c0256565791626583583a8d96fa00798bdb4192f2694070

2 Input
2 Outputs
  • 595c62e274c719b33c0256565791626583583a8d96fa00798bdb4192f2694070:0
  • value  47676000
    address  12tbeXVnWmNUWpbeLSvas1Z4WABw1JwYYC
  • 595c62e274c719b33c0256565791626583583a8d96fa00798bdb4192f2694070:1
  • value  175520780
    address  12BTj1xQp4KNsdNZE6KfXdYaAEC3VPSvSb